The boa constrictor (scientific name also Boa constrictor), also known as the red-tailed boa, is a species of large, non-venomous, heavy-bodied snake that is frequently kept and bred in captivity. [5] [6] The boa constrictor is a member of the family Boidae. The species is native to tropical South America.

Web9 Dec 2024 · Incidentally, male snakes and lizards have two penises apiece. The reptiles are endowed with a paired sex organ called the hemipenes; there's a right hemipenis and a left hemipenis, each connected to one of the testicles.
